Celebrating Our Centennial

Starting in fall 2020, Country Club Christian Church will begin a year-long celebration of 100 years of ministry in Kansas City. Mark your calendar for these Centennial events, and watch for more information about other celebrations throughout the year. Incarnation – Tyler Heston

When we celebrate Christmas, we celebrate incarnation; the story of Christ’s birth is the story of God taking on human flesh.
